Badjharan
Badjharan is a village located in Tikaetpali tehsil of Sundargarh district in Odisha, India. It is situated 30km away from sub-district headquarter Tikaetpali (tehsildar office) and 24km away from district headquarter Sundargarh. As per 2009 stats, Kasada is the gram panchayat of Badjharan village.

About Badjharan
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Badjharan is 385084. The village spans a total geographical area of 14 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 770051. Raurkela is nearest town to Badjharan village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 93km away.

Population of Badjharan
According to the 2011 Census, Badjharan has a total population of about 55, with approximately 28 males and 27 females. The sex ratio is around 964 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 16 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 55. The overall literacy rate is approximately 3.64%, with male literacy at about 3.57% and female literacy near 3.70%.
